Chemical Constituents from Dragon's Blood of Dracaena cambodiana
2011
Luo, Ying | DAI, Hao-Fu | Wang, Hui | MEI, Wen-Li
AIM: To investigate the chemical constituents from dragon's blood of Dracaena cambodiana in Hainan. METHODS: Compounds were purified by silica gel and Sephadex LH-20 column chromatography, and their structures were identified on the basis of physicochemical properties and spectroscopic data. RESULTS: Eight compounds were isolated and identified as syringaresinol (1), pinoresinol (2), balanophonin (3), 2-(4-hydroxyphenyl)-6-(3-methoxy-4-hydroxyphenyl)-3, 7-dioxabicyclo[3.3.0]octane (4), 5, 7- dihydroxy-4′-methoxy-8-methylflavane (5), 7, 4′-dihydroxy-8-methoxyhomoisoflavane (6), (2R)-7, 4′-dihydroxy-8-methylflavane (7) and (2S)-7, 3′-dihydroxy-4′-methoxyflavane (8). CONCLUSION: Compounds 1–8 were reported from the dragon′s blood of D. cambodiana for the first time.
